本文实例为大家分享了vue实现鼠标移入移出事件的具体代码,供大家参考,具体内容如下<div class="index_tableTitle clearfix" v-for="(item,index) in table_tit"><div class="indexItem"><span :title="item.name">{{item.name}}</span><span class="mypor"><i class="icon" @mouseenter="enter(index)" @mouseleave="leave()"></i><div v-show="seen&&index==current" class="index-show"><div class="tip_Wrapinner">{{item.det...
这篇文章主要介绍了通过vue写一个瀑布流插件代码实例,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下
效果如图所示:采用了预先加载图片,再计算高度的办法。。网络差的情况下,可能有点卡
新建 vue-water-easy.vue 组件文件
<template><div class="vue-water-easy" ref="waterWrap"><div v-for="(items,clos) in list" :key="clos" :style="waterStyle" class="colsW"><ul><l...
Echarts实现可视化世界地图模拟迁徙,以我自己开发过程。
下载Echarts依赖:
npm install echarts
成功以后引入依赖:
import echarts from 'echarts'
peopleInsertCharts为生成echarts容器。
let myChart = echarts.init(document.getElementById(peopleInsertCharts))容器一定要给宽高,否则echarts生成初始化页面不会显示。需要自适应的可以js获取宽高给定容器。
直接贴代码
// 绘制图表myChart.setOption({title: {text: demo...
思路:
要实现无限轮播,需要在轮播图前后各加一张图片,加在前面的是轮播图的最后一张图片(重复的),加在后面的是轮播图的第一张图片(重复的)。例:
<div class="wrapper-content"><img class="wrapper-content_img" alt="4" src="img/4.jpg"/><img class="wrapper-content_img" alt="1" src="img/1.jpg"/><img class="wrapper-content_img" alt="2" src="img/2.jpg"/><img class="wrapper-content_img" alt="3" src="img/3.j...
话不多说先上效果图,本文引荐链接https://www.gxlcms.com/article/129112.htm
这个是html,
<template><div><div class="back_add"><div class="threeImg"><div class="Containt"><div class="iconleft" @click="zuohua"><i class="el-icon-arrow-left"></i></div><ul :style="{left:calleft + px}" v-on:mouseover="stopmove()" v-on:mouseout="move()"><li v-for="(item,index) in superurl" :key="index"><img :src="item.img"/...
1、使用vue来实现一般搜索
<form action="" @submit="submitQuery" class="all_two"><el-input v-model="input" placeholder="请输入内容" ref="search" style="width:300px;"></el-input>
</form>
<div class="all_three"><div v-for="item in this.$store.state.chufang.alldata"><div v-for="item1 in queryDate(item.cabinet)" ><input type="checkbox" name="checkbox" value="checkbox" style="zoom:200%;" :checked="item1....
今天中午废了一会时间,总算把项目中的购物车的单选、全选、以及实现数据的动态显示做出来了,给小白分享一下我个人一个解决办法:
购物车的基本页面如下:先说实现的总体思路
1.给table表中表头th加一个 checkbox,设这两个事件:@click=”checkAll” v-model=”checkall”;2.给对应的tr加一个 checkbox 绑定一个事件 v-model=”checked”,checked设为数组,专门放商品Id;3.由于checkall默认为false,当我勾选全选框时,将check...
1.在index.html引入高德地图JSAPI<script src="https://webapi.amap.com/maps?v=1.3&key=xxx"></script>2.地图dom
<div class="map-container"><div id="container" style="width:100%;height:500px"></div>
</div>3.js实现
export default {data() {},methods:{initMap(){let map = new AMap.Map(container, {features: [bg, road],resizeEnable: true,center: [116.397428, 39.90923],zoom: 11,viewMode: 2D,pitch: 50,showZoomB...
本文实例为大家分享了vue格式化时间过滤器的具体代码,供大家参考,具体内容如下<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Document</title>
<script src="https://unpkg.com/vue"></script>
</head>
<body>
<div id="app">
<div>
{{ message | formatTime(YMD)}}
</div>
<div>
{{ message | formatTime(YMDHMS)}}
</div>
<div>
{{ message | formatTime(HMS)}}
</div>
<div>
{{...
vue获取时间戳转换为日期格式。
方法一为转载黄轶老师的format方法:出处(黄轶老师github https://github.com/ustbhuangyi);
// date.js
export function formatDate (date, fmt) {if (/(y+)/.test(fmt)) {fmt = fmt.replace(RegExp.$1, (date.getFullYear() + ).substr(4 - RegExp.$1.length));}let o = {M+: date.getMonth() + 1,d+: date.getDate(),h+: date.getHours(),m+: date.getMinutes(),s+: date.getSeconds()};fo...
下面给出一个效果图,我今天要说的就是实现下图这种多个倒计时很多时候我们做只有一个倒计时的情况比较多,比较简单只需要一个定时器setInterval,算出来赋赋值就好,
但是需要多个倒计时的时候我们就要考虑把倒计时封装成通用的方法了
拿我自己的vue项目举个例<!-- template --><div v-for="(item,index) in list" :key="index" class="act_item"><h1>{{ item.title }}</h1><img :src="item.pic" alt=""><div class="act_info"><h...
本文实例为大家分享了vue进入页面时滚动条始终在底部的具体代码,供大家参考,具体内容如下mounted () {this.scrollToBottom();
},
//每次页面渲染完之后滚动条在最底部
updated:function(){this.scrollToBottom();
},
methods:{scrollToBottom: function () {this.$nextTick(() => {var container = this.$el.querySelector(".chatBox-content-demo");container.scrollTop = container.scrollHeight;})
}
}滚动条样式:
::-webkit...
除了使用 <router-link> 创建 a 标签来定义导航链接,我们还可以借助 router 的实例方法,通过编写代码来实现。即:通过js动态的进行导航链接。
一、this.$router.push( )
router.push(location, onComplete, onAbort)
注意:在 Vue 实例内部,你可以通过 $router 访问路由实例。因此你可以调用 this.$router.push。
想要导航到不同的 URL,则使用 router.push 方法。这个方法会向 history 栈添加一个新的记录,所以,当用户点击浏...
最近写vue2.0项目中用到了轮播图的一个插件,也就是vue-awesome-swiper,个人感觉还是比较强大的,swiper官网中的API及配置均可使用(支持3.0),以下说下使用该插件的一些步骤:第一步安装npm install vue-awesome-swiper --save第二部在main.js中引入import Vue from vue
import VueAwesomeSwiper from vue-awesome-swiper
Vue.use(VueAwesomeSwiper)然后就可以在组件中使用该插件
<template> <div> <swiper :options="swiperOptio...